Position Summary

TheGuest Services Associateis a dedicated and compassionateteammatesupportingOliver Gospel’s Men’s Recovery Programsand Shelter. TheGuest Services Associateservesas themainfront desk point of contactfor individualsentering the Men’s program or seekingshelterservices, support, andotherresources. This roleis crucialin ensuring a welcoming and organized environment forguests/program members, partners,and othervisitors.

Position Responsibilities
  • Greetvisitorsand guestscourteously and professionally.
  • Provide information about available services, programs, and resources offered at the shelter and recovery center.
  • Maintain a clean and organized front desk area andmaintain shift communication log.
  • Registervisitors and/orassistguestprogramguestswith intake proceduresas needed
  • Assistwithconfirming bed assignments,conductingpersonal belonging searches, anddrug/alcoholsubstance screeningswhenrequired.
  • Answer phone calls, respond to inquiries, and direct calls to theappropriate staffmembers.
  • Assistwith administrative tasks such asreception organizing,filing, data entry, record-keeping, and other common reception duties.
  • Become proficient in all aspects of Oliver Gospel’s HMIS and other required systems.
  • Communicate effectively withprogramguests, staff, and volunteers tofacilitatea positive and supportive environment.
  • Collaborate with other team members to address client needs and concerns promptly and effectivelyto includestrong collaboration withprogramstaff and Life Coaches.
  • Provideparticipantcountsfor Chapelservices andspecial events/activities in the facility.
  • Assistwith providing linens, hygiene items,and meals.
  • Assist with receivingandrecordingdonation itemsandtaking and submitting requests.
  • Assistwithoperatingthe sound system and Smart TV in Oliver Hall when needed.
  • HelpfacilitateRapid Shelter/Cold Weathershelter.
  • Drive companyvehiclesand transport guestswhen needed(approvedMVRrequired).
  • Develop relationships with Refresh guests andchart/reporttheir needs and behaviors
  • Assistwith dispensingmedicationsas needed.
  • Work with relevant staff to ensure programguestshave proper clothing and essentials upon entry and throughout the programs.
  • Monitor and ensure the security of the front desk and other facility areas on and off camera.
  • Deescalate and provide support for people in crises,deferringto Life Coaches or Managers when facing escalated situations.
  • Report all policy violations,substance abuse/suspicion,and/or otherthreats oflife or health threatsto staff or programguests.
  • Enforce shelter program structure, policy, standards, and protocols, including ensuringthefront deskis never left unattended withoutdirectcoverageand/or is locked up securely with approval (programguestsnever left in the facility without proper staff supervision).
  • Perform other duties as assigned by the supervisor.
